hero-image

Výuka databázových předmětů na Katedře informatiky

Administrace databázových systémů

Pokyny pro období zrušené výuky

  • Výuka nyní bude probíhat samostudiem. Na každý týden vám přijdou pokyny emailem.
  • Bodované úkoly budou prozatím probíhat vzdáleně. Jinými slovy každý jej bude řešit samostatně ze svého domu/práce. Všechny termíny i pokyny jsou nyní společné jak pro kombinovanou tak pro prezenční výuku.
  • Pokud se termínu některého bodovaného úkolu nemůžete zůčastnit, je potřeba se předem omluvit, jinak budete hodnoceni nula body.
  • Body jsou uvedeny zde.

Vzdálené přihlášení

V předmětu bude mít každý student svůj virtuální stroj na kterém bude provádět všechny praktické úkoly. Zde je seznam IP adres jednotlivých studentů.

Bodované úkoly na cvičení

Na čtyřech cvičeních budou probíhat bodované úkoly. Dva na SQLServer a dva na Oracle. Každé bodované cvičení bude hodnoceno až dvaceti body. Postupně budou zveřejňovány typové příklady ke každému bodovanému cvičení. Zde je možné nahlédnou do průběžných výsledků.
Harmonogram cvičení:

  1. První sada úkolů k SQL Serveru.
  2. Druhá sada úkolů k SQL Serveru.
  3. První bodované cvičení k SQL Serveru (max 20 bodů).
  4. Příprava na druhý bodovaný úkol.
  5. Druhé bodované cvičení k SQL Serveru (max 20 bodů).
  6. První sada úkolů k Oracle.
  7. Druhá sada úkolů k Oracle.
  8. První bodované cvičení k Oracle (max 20 bodů) - 30.3., 13:00
  9. Druhý bodovaný úkol k Oracle (max 20 bodů) - 8.4. 12:30
  10. Diskuze a ukázky zpracovaných projektů (ukázka zprovoznění vybraného DBMS) (max 20 bodů)

Projekt - zprovoznění vybraného DBMS

V rámci předmětu je možné získat 20 bodů za zprovoznění a zdokumentování základní administrace některého  databázového systému z tohoto seznamu:

  • Hive
  • Firebird
  • Spark SQL
  • Impala
  • Greenplum
  • H2
  • Ingres
  • VoltDB
  • NuoDB
  • MongoDB - Szkandera
  • CouchDB
  • Redis - Albert
  • OrientDB - Kovacs
  • ElasticSearch
  • Solr - Hlaváč

Pokud by jste rádi některou DBMS zprovoznili, pak je potřeba se předem domluvit s přednášejícím (pošlete email). Zde můžete nalézt podrobné pokyny pro vypracování tohoto úkolu. Vypracování je potřeba poslat do 13.4.

Instalace Oracle

Do šestého cvičení je nutné nainstalovat Oracle. Oracle je připraven v adresáři c:\install. Soubor setup.exe spouštějte v roli admin. Při instalaci vyberte následující volby:

  • Create and configure database
  • Server class
  • Single instance database instalation.
  • Typical install
  • Create new windows user
  • Global database name nastavte na ORCL, nevybírejte Create as container DB

Oprava Enterprise Manageru

Děkuji Heleně Šubertové za nalezení následujícího postupu pro oživení EM express v Oracle 12c.

Prosím vyzkoušejte následujícího postup pro oživení EM express v Oracle 12c.

 

Přednášky a cvičení

TýdenPřednáškaCvičení
1.SQL Server - Úvod, Systemový katalog, Nastavení, Úložné struktury, Zabezpečení
pdf
Manuál k SQL Serveru
Úkoly na cvičení (SQL Server)
2.SQL Server - Zabezpečení, Zotavení, Záloha
pdf
Úkoly na cvičení (SQL Server)
3.SQL Server - Monitorování
pdf
Bodovaný úkol 1
4.SQL Server - Monitorování a ladění
pdf
Úkoly na cvičení (SQL Server)
aukce.zip
skripty.zip
5.Oracle - Nástroje, Nastavení, Systémový katalog, Úložné struktury
pdf    Video
 
6.Oracle - Zabezpečení, Audit, Export a import dat, Zotavení a záloha, Plánovač
pdf    Video

Bodovaný úkol 2 - 18.3, 12:30

Manuál k Oracle
Úkoly na cvičení (Oracle)
Řešení úkolů

7.Oracle - Monitorování
pdf

Bodovaný úkol 3 - 30.3., 12:30

Pokyny ke čtvrtému bodovanému úkolu
aukce_oracle.zip